[PATCH] mm: mglru: Fix soft lockup attributed to scanning folios

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



After we enabled mglru on our 384C1536GB production servers, we
encountered frequent soft lockups attributed to scanning folios.

The soft lockup as follows,

>From our analysis of the vmcore generated by the soft lockup, the thread
was waiting for the spinlock lruvec->lru_lock:

There were a total of 22 tasks waiting for this spinlock
(RDI: ffff99d2b6ff9050):

 crash> foreach RU bt | grep -B 8  queued_spin_lock_slowpath |  grep "RDI: ffff99d2b6ff9050" | wc -l
 22

Additionally, two other threads were also engaged in scanning folios, one
with 19 waiters and the other with 15 waiters.

To address this issue under heavy reclaim conditions, we introduced a
hotfix version of the fix, incorporating cond_resched() in scan_folios().
Following the application of this hotfix to our servers, the soft lockup
issue ceased.
